What you'll do
- Manage fluid and HVAC components across the campus, including pumps, compressors, valves, and heat exchangers.
- Create CAD models and perform detailed designs for facility systems.
- Conduct fluid analysis to determine consumables, pressure balance, and component design limits.
- Coordinate with internal teams like avionics, production, and mission operations to ensure systems meet program requirements.
- Oversee material selection, procurement, and hardware sizing.
- Ensure all designs are reliable and optimized for manufacturing to minimize long-term maintenance.
- Specify and integrate pressure and temperature instrumentation to validate system performance.
- Develop layout strategies for air ducting and mechanical systems to optimize flow and accessibility.
- Apply GD&T and mechanical codes to communicate precise manufacturing instructions.
- Perform structural assessments to confirm integrity under operational and environmental loads.
- Lead projects independently, defining scope, schedule, and technical baselines for complex installations.
- Evaluate new component technologies and standards to drive continuous improvement in facility design.
